How the Thermal Imaging System Works



At the heart of Raythink's new offering is a sophisticated combination of a 360° infrared panoramic camera and a multispectral PTZ (pan-tilt-zoom) camera. This setup enables continuous, round-the-clock surveillance capable of conducting complete 360° scans in just two seconds. When suspicious objects or activities are detected, the PTZ cameras immediately take over to provide high-resolution images and aid in identifying potential threats.

The system's capabilities allow for real-time tracking and recognition of up to 200 objects simultaneously. Utilizing proprietary AI technology, it can distinguish between people, vehicles, and wildlife, ensuring comprehensive monitoring with minimal false alarms. Additionally, it features intelligent behavior analysis that detects unusual activities and generates immediate alerts for timely responses. Importantly, it integrates fire safety protocols by providing early smoke and fire detection, further bolstering site security.

Tailored for the Challenges of Illegal Mining



Illegal miners often operate under the cover of night or in poorly lit conditions, where conventional surveillance systems reliant on visible light struggle. Raythink’s thermal imaging solution specifically addresses these challenges by focusing on heat signatures, providing accurate and reliable monitoring capabilities regardless of lighting conditions.

Illegal mining sites can span vast geographical areas, with operations often extending across hundreds of square kilometers. A single Raythink station can effectively cover distances of up to 2 kilometers, making it scalable to accommodate larger regions through integration with Raythink's proprietary VIS-4100 cloud platform. This platform supports electronic mapping, allowing operators to visualize equipment locations, set up virtual fences for restricted areas, and monitor real-time alerts effectively.

Enhancing Compliance with Advanced Monitoring



The installation of monitoring systems is not just a strategic choice but a regulatory requirement for many mining operations. According to the International Labour Organization’s (ILO) C176 guidelines, risk monitoring and accident prevention are imperative. In the EU, directives 89/391/EEC and 92/91/EEC mandate comprehensive risk assessments and monitoring in high-risk environments. Similarly, nations in Africa, including South Africa, Zambia, and Botswana, require extensive safety measures in their mining sectors.

Raythink’s AI thermal imaging solution captures both thermal and visual data, tracking multiple targets while recording unusual activities. This feature provides verifiable evidence for audits and regulatory compliance, ensuring that operators can meet the necessary safety standards while safeguarding their operations.
